Dutch city’s heat network expanded

BAM and the municipal energy provider of the Dutch city of Roosendaal, Thermaflex have cooperated in the expansion of an innovative, low-temperature district heating network.

The residents of the Nieuwe Wipwei district in Roosendaal will benefit from the low carbon heating as the city continues to realise its sustainability targets. Waste heat from the local SUEZ waste processing plant will be used to provide the heat.
